Lady Gaga is acting in the second season of "Wednesday," which will hit Netflix later this year (and which has already netted a third season from the streamer). To the surprise of nobody, Gaga will also have a song in the second season, with a video for the song being released around the same time. Synergy!
The song in question is called "Dead Dance," which is befitting a show like "Wednesday." Gaga's presence is also befitting a show like "Wednesday," at least when she is in a certain mode. Gaga is either a chameleon or an empty vessel who blows in the wind in whatever direction behooves her professionally, depending on your feelings about her.
Gaga wasn't at the premiere screening of "Wednesday" season two, as she is still on her tour supporting her most-recent album "Mayhem." Given the likely overlap between Gaga's so-called "Little Monsters" and "Wednesday" fans, one assumes "Dead Dance" will go over like gangbusters. It certainly is better than Rihanna's "Smurfs" song.
